For the great bulk of houses, central air conditioning installation is complex and stuffed with risk to try without expert help. This is owing to the knowledge required, the governmental wrangling of consents and licensing requirements, and the threat of voiding guarantees if the parts are set up mistakenly.
A central air conditioning conditioner cools air in one area prior to distributing it throughout the residence using the furnace’s air handling abilities. This sets it apart from window or wall air conditioning system or mini-split systems, which all chill fairly small areas and need many systems to cool the whole house.
Many single-family houses in the United States with central air conditioning utilize a split system. This indicates that the gadget is divided into 2 parts: an evaporator coil within a compressor and the home outside.

Your professional will assist you in identifying the suitable size main air conditioner for your home. A system that is too small will run virtually continually, whereas a unit that is too big will chill the house too quickly and shut off prior to finishing a full cycle.
The fast on/off in the latter circumstance is taxing on the system. It can trigger the evaporator coil to freeze, and a frozen coil avoids air from streaming. As a result, a huge a/c might be less effective at cooling than a smaller sized unit.
Your Air Conditioner installation will do a computation understood as a “Manual-J” to determine the very best system for your house. This will take into consideration all of the criteria we’ve discussed and more, leading to the most precise size possible.
We understand that numerous property owners like to have a basic notion of what size they need ahead of time. central air conditioner size: To get the Btu essential, increase the square video of your home’s conditioned area by 25, then divide by 12,000 to acquire the tonnage.

Prices vary based on the regional market and the job details, just like any substantial project. For labor and materials, a common split system main air installation using an existing heating system might cost in between $3,000 and $7,000 or more. Typically, that cost will be divided around 60/40, with labor accounting for most of it.
